I saw a show about the battle of Kursk, and a T-34 crew that survived the battle were talking about the rations they got per day. Something like 500 grams of bread per person, a bottle of vodka per tank, some butter or cheese, canned vegetables or meat. Then one of the guys said "when we were lucky, we got a can of American supplied Spam. Those were the good days." You could see the little tear in his eye that memory brought out.
